ISOTOPECONST_DOUBLE IsotopeConst::Titanium50AtomicMass = 49.944785839 |
\( m_a\ (u) \) Atomic mass of Titanium-50 in unified atomic mass units.
ISOTOPECONST_DOUBLE IsotopeConst::Titanium50AtomicMassUnc = 1.29e-07 |
\( \Delta m_a\ (u) \) Uncertainty in atomic mass of Titanium-50 in unified atomic mass units.
ISOTOPECONST_DOUBLE IsotopeConst::Titanium50BindEPerA = 8755.718 |
\( BE/A\ (keV) \) Binding energy per nucleon of Titanium-50 in keV.
ISOTOPECONST_DOUBLE IsotopeConst::Titanium50BindEPerAUnc = 0.002 |
\( \Delta BE/A\ (keV) \) Uncertainty in binding energy per A of Titanium-50 in keV.
ISOTOPECONST_DOUBLE IsotopeConst::Titanium50MassExc = -51431.66 |
\( ME (keV) \) Mass excess of Titanium-50 in keV.
ISOTOPECONST_DOUBLE IsotopeConst::Titanium50MassExcUnc = 0.121 |
\( \Delta ME\ (keV) \) Uncertainty in mass excess of Titanium-50 in keV.
ISOTOPECONST_INT IsotopeConst::Titanium50MassNumber = 50 |
\( A \) Mass number of Titanium-50.
ISOTOPECONST_INT IsotopeConst::Titanium50Neutrons = 28 |
\( N \) Neutrons in Titanium-50.
ISOTOPECONST_INT IsotopeConst::Titanium50Protons = 22 |
\( Z \) Protons in Titanium-50.
